You hear horror stories of passengers kicked off cruise ships in a foreign country when a medical emergency has occurred. What should you do if this happens to you?
Travel Safety Tips
1. Use a Travel Professional
A trusted travel consultant acts as your advocate, helps communicate with the cruise line, and supports you in emergencies.
2. Register with STEP
Enroll in the State Department's Smart Traveler Enrollment Program for access to English-speaking consular help anywhere you go.
3. Buy Travel Insurance
Essential for peace of mind! Travel insurance provides 24/7 emergency assistance, helps with medical costs upfront, translation help, and arranges your safe return home.
4. Get a Pre-Trip Health Check
Be honest about your health and discuss your travel plans with your doctor. Understand your limits and review any medical conditions that could impact your trip.
5. Prepare a Will & Consent Forms
Have formal wills and, if you have kids at home, notarized parental consent forms ready before you travel—emergencies happen unexpectedly.
